Self-Narrating Neural Networks: Real-Time Natural Language Explanations During Machine Learning Training

Description
This paper introduces "Self-Narrating Neural Networks" - a system where machine learning models explain their training process in real-time using natural language instead of technical metrics. A proof-of-concept study with 2 students on ECG classification shows technical feasibility and preliminary evidence of improved understanding and faster problem detection. While the small sample size limits conclusions, the work demonstrates a novel approach to making ML training more accessible and provides a foundation for larger-scale investigation.
